Pass by: Castle Clinton Monument, located at the southern tip of Manhattan in Battery Park, is a historic fort that dates back to 1808. Originally built to defend New York Harbor, it has since served various roles, including an entertainment venue, immigration station, and aquarium. Today, it's a National Monument that offers a glimpse into New York City's rich history and serves as a gateway to the Statue of Liberty.

Pass by: Battery Park, located at the southern tip of Manhattan, is a historic waterfront park offering stunning views of New York Harbor and the Statue of Liberty. Established in the early 19th century, it features beautiful gardens, memorials, and the historic Castle Clinton Monument. The park is a popular spot for leisurely walks and serves as the departure point for ferries to the Statue of Liberty and Ellis Island.

Pass by: The New York Stock Exchange (NYSE), located on Wall Street in the Financial District, is the largest and most famous stock exchange in the world. Established in 1792, its iconic neoclassical building is a symbol of global finance. The exterior, adorned with grand columns and the American flag, represents the heart of the U.S. economy and is a must-see landmark in New York City.
